Hi people I want to convert my tomtom files (oov2) to work on my Garmin unit which i have just bought, (csv) Does anyone know how or if this can be done , and where ican get the programme to do it from...Thanks |

I find one of the easiest methods is to use POI Edit you can find more details HERE use the Tools/ Batch Convert option- Mike |

Voices are a totaly different issue, what are you trying to do? you can't use a TomTom voice file on a Garmin it simply won't work - well not without some serious messing around and even then bits will still be missing - Mike |
